(MANASQUAN, NJ) -- Algonquin Arts Theatre is presenting Pippin from May 8–17, 2026. There's magic to do when a prince learns the true meaning of glory, love and war in Stephen Schwartz's iconic and unforgettable musical masterpiece. Photographer John Posada was on hand to take photos.

Heir to the Frankish throne, the young prince Pippin is in search of the secret to true happiness and fulfillment. He seeks it in the glories of the battlefield, the temptations of the flesh and the intrigues of political power (after disposing of his father, King Charlemagne the Great). In the end, though, Pippin finds that happiness lies not in extraordinary endeavors, but rather in the unextraordinary moments that happen every day.

With unforgettable songs, mesmerizing choreography, and a touch of magic, this Tony Award®-winning classic invites audiences to experience the extraordinary in the ordinary.

Leading the cast is Matthew Paul Johnson in the title role of Pippin, alongside Natalie Hayes-Scott as the Leading Player, Savannah Fouchi as Catherine, David Fusco as Charlemagne, Danny Marks as Lewis, Colleen Renee Lis as Fastrada, Lynne Truex as Berthe, and Parker Spagnuolo as Theo. They are joined by a dynamic ensemble of Players who bring this magical and theatrical journey to life.

The creative team for Pippin includes: Jessica O'Brien (Director/Choreographer), Mark Megill (Music Director), Onali Rosado (Stage Manager), Jason Greenhouse (Scenic Designer), Roman Klima (Lighting Designer), Jan Topoleski (Sound Designer) and Joesph Ficarra (Properties).

Pippin features Music and Lyrics by Stephen Schwartz; Book by Roger O. Hirson.

In addition to Pippin, Stephen Schwartz is known for works like Godspell, Pippin,The Baker's Wife, and Children of Eden. Roger O. Hirson is best known for his work on Pippin and Walking Happy. He also wrote many screenplays and stories.

Algonquin Arts Theatre (AAT) is a 501(c)(3) nonprofit center for performing arts, providing cultural enrichment and arts education for residents and visitors of Central New Jersey and the Jersey Shore through high-quality performances and programs in theatre, music, dance, and film. Located in Manasquan, N.J., AAT is an integral part of the Shore region and is deeply committed to education and community engagement.

Algonquin Arts Theatre's programs are made possible in part by funds from the New Jersey State Council on the Arts / Department of State, a partner agency of the National Endowment for the Arts, along with support from corporate partners, foundations, and individual donors.
